A fallen stone in water

A splash, and then it's gone 

But a surprise awaits inside

The ripples circle on and on


How many can you count

One and two or three

This leads us to wonder

Where the end will be


A fallen carless phrase in mouth

Soon you might forget

But the little waves are flowing

And suddenly, the ripple circles are set


A heart that has been punctured

A mighty crash of tears you stirred

Disrupted a once happy soul

Where you dropped the unkind word


A fallen act of love in air 

Though small can help you smile

And when you do, you pass it on

The ripples circle for a while


Bringing hope and joy and peace 

With each, a dashing wave

Till you won’t believe the volume

Of the one kind word you gave


So in this pail that you carry

With your actions you must be clever

One false move can cost an army and...

These ripples, they last forever


The author's comments:

This piece is about the ripples effect and how our lives are impacted through it. It is based off of the idea that when a pebble is dropped in water, the ripples are everlasting. This can be juxtaposed to our words and actions toward others.
